// Heads up, plugin authors: these constants govern how Bucketloom assigns
// users to experiment arms. Assignment is sticky per user, hashed against
// the experiment salt, so don't expect reshuffles mid-experiment. If your
// plugin overrides bucketing weights, stay within the documented bounds or
// the validator will reject your config. The defaults are as follows.

tuning table, kajog-kawef:
PRIORITIES = {
    "kelox": 870,
    "kasix": 89,
    "eliax": 988,
}

## Runbook: Weather-alert fan-out

When the Gustrelay core receives a severe-weather event, it fans out to registered plugin endpoints in priority order. Plugin authors: your handler must acknowledge within five seconds or Gustrelay retries twice, then parks the event in the dead-letter stream. Delivery payloads are signed, and your plugin verifies them with a shared secret provisioned per plugin. Before testing locally, confirm your endpoint is registered in the sandbox tier, then add the signing secret to your env file on the line below:

sealed setting: ARCHIVE_KEY3=8d0

Ticket FERN-212: Config drift on the Sproutline watering scheduler, again. Staging and prod disagree on the soak interval and the dry-spell override, so the greenhouse bots in the Pell Street test rack watered twice on Tuesday. Can we agree at the sync to make staging the source of truth and re-sync prod? For reference, here's what staging is currently running with.

service settings:
novath:
  pin: 1396
  tenant: pelys
  seal: seal_ccc035e1
  metrics_host: metrics.novath.qorvelworks.test
  standby_team: fraeth
  escalation: drueth-zorok
  nonce: 61d508

Subject: DR drill follow-up — build agent clock skew

Tavi — during yesterday's drill, agents brill-3 and brill-7 drifted 40+ seconds, which broke artifact signing on the Ostrell pipeline. Fix is queued. To re-seal the signing store after the fix lands, you'll need the recovery passphrase, which is noted directly below.

unlock words, yawig-kagef: gordor-holvan-ulaael-pramir-ulaiel-tamdor